Smithfield Beach is a grassy beach on the Delaware River that is the perfect place to start many summer adventures. This beach allows swimming year round, and has lifeguards on duty seasonally. Swimming is also allowed on other areas of the Delaware River, but is at your own risk and not recommended.

Smithfield Beach features a boat launch and a canoe launch. This is a popular launch spot for the 7 mile float from Smithfield Beach to Delaware Water Gap. These two points make for perfect put in and take out places, with boat launches and close parking lots.

The beach also has restrooms and picnic tables available to visitors. Grills are allowed, but visitors must bring their own.

Smithfield Beach is an National Park Amenity and charges a small entry fee, $7 per vehicle or $1 for pedestrian entry. Entry is half price for those with an America the Beautiful Pass and season passes are also available. Visitors coming on holiday weekends should arrive early as the parking lot fills up.
